Setting clear financial goals can provide direction and motivation for achieving them from "summary" of The Concise Psychology of Money by Morgan Housel
When it comes to managing money, having a clear sense of direction is crucial. Setting specific financial goals can act as a guiding light, helping you navigate the complexities of personal finance with purpose and determination. Without clear objectives in mind, it's easy to feel lost or uncertain about where you're headed financially. By defining your financial aspirations, you give yourself a tangible target to work towards. This can provide a sense of motivation and focus that might otherwise be lacking. When you have a clear endpoint in sight, it becomes easier to make decisions that align with your long-term goals. Moreover, setting financial goals allows you to track your progress and celebrate your achievements along the way. Each milestone reached serves as a reminder of your capabilities and reinforces your commitment to your financial well-being. Without these markers of success, it can be challenging to stay motivated and maintain momentum in your financial journey. Having a sense of direction also helps you prioritize your spending and saving habits. When you have a clear understanding of what you're working towards, it becomes easier to distinguish between wants and needs. This can lead to more intentional financial choices that support your overarching goals.- Setting clear financial goals provides a roadmap for your financial future. It gives you a sense of purpose and direction, motivating you to take the necessary steps to achieve your aspirations. By defining your objectives, tracking your progress, and making intentional choices, you can build a solid foundation for long-term financial success.
